This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

Sophos Management Service Error 0x80004005

Hi

We are using SEC 4 on Windows 2003 R2 x64. Our Sophos management server rebooted for Windows updates last night and the management Service will not start up with the error 0x80004005.

We recently had to rename our domain and had previously encountered error 0x80004005 which was fixed by following step three of http://www.sophos.com/support/knowledgebase/article/16195.html

However, after the updates the service is failing to start again and the above KB no longer fixes the problem.

I have included excerpts of the management services logs below.

sophos-management-data.log

[Begin]
2010-08-13 09:04:31,517 [3] ERROR {Sophos.Management.Data.SPErrorHandler.CheckReturnCode} [(null)]
    |====> Call to SP dbo.ComputerBasedPolicyByTypeAndNameGet returned error code 22
2010-08-13 09:04:31,767 [3] ERROR {Sophos.Management.Data.DAUpdateHandler.da_RowUpdated} [(null)]
    |====> Exception thrown by command dbo.ComputerBasedPolicyAdd (System.Data.SqlClient.SqlException: Cannot insert duplicate key row in object 'dbo.ComputerPolicyMapping' with unique index 'IX_ComputerPolicyMapping_ComputerID_Type_UC'.
The statement has been terminated.
sqlfile(36): Error inserting to ComputerPolicyMapping).
2010-08-13 09:04:31,767 [3] ERROR {Sophos.Management.Data.SPErrorHandler.AnalyseAndConvertException} [(null)]
    |====> Command execution attempted to violate unique index or primary key
[End]

sophos-management-services.log

[Begin]
2010-08-13 09:04:28,923 [3] INFO  {Sophos.Management.Services.Messaging.Handler.AfterPropertiesSet} [(null)]
     |====> Number of receivers registered 4
2010-08-13 09:04:28,923 [3] INFO  {Sophos.Management.Services.Messaging.Handler.AfterPropertiesSet} [(null)]
     |====> Registering for events from: Sophos.Management.Services.MessageReceiverBase to : SCF
2010-08-13 09:04:28,923 [3] INFO  {Sophos.Management.Services.Messaging.Handler.AfterPropertiesSet} [(null)]
     |====> Registering for events from: Sophos.Management.Services.Nac.MessageReceiver to : NAC
2010-08-13 09:04:28,923 [3] INFO  {Sophos.Management.Services.Messaging.Handler.AfterPropertiesSet} [(null)]
     |====> Registering for events from: Sophos.Management.Services.Sddma.MessageReceiver to : SDDM
2010-08-13 09:04:28,923 [3] INFO  {Sophos.Management.Services.Messaging.Handler.AfterPropertiesSet} [(null)]
     |====> Registering for events from: Sophos.Management.Services.MessageReceiverBase to : SAV
2010-08-13 09:04:28,939 [3] INFO  {Sophos.Management.Services.ServicesCore.GetService} [(null)]
     |====> GetService SystemSecretCollector
2010-08-13 09:04:28,939 [3] INFO  {Sophos.Management.Services.ServicesCore.GetService} [(null)]
     |====> Spring is aware of service - delegating
2010-08-13 09:04:28,939 [3] INFO  {Sophos.Management.Services.ServicesCore.GetService} [(null)]
     |====> GetService SddmaService
2010-08-13 09:04:28,939 [3] INFO  {Sophos.Management.Services.ServicesCore.GetService} [(null)]
     |====> Spring is aware of service - delegating
2010-08-13 09:04:31,532 [3] WARN  {Sophos.Management.Services.Sddma.UpstreamPolicyRepository.GetByServer} [(null)]
     |====> GetByName for 3d941439-3149-408d-b98b-bec12f654032 didn't work. Returning default policy.
[End]

Any help would be greatly appreciated,

Regards,

James Beck

:4596


This thread was automatically locked due to age.
Parents Reply Children
No Data